Analisando as definições apresentadas nas alternativas:
A) Os requisitos funcionais podem ser expressos como metas que caracterizam as propriedades do sistema e seus objetivos - Esta definição não está correta, pois os requisitos funcionais são as funcionalidades específicas que o sistema deve fornecer.
B) Os requisitos não-funcionais são declarações de todos os serviços e restrições que o software deve possuir, mediante as necessidades do cliente ou usuário - Esta definição está correta, pois os requisitos não-funcionais referem-se a aspectos como desempenho, segurança, usabilidade, entre outros, que não são funcionalidades específicas do sistema.
C) Os requisitos funcionais são declarações que definem as qualidades globais ou atributos a serem atendidos pelo sistema resultante - Esta definição não está correta, pois se refere mais aos requisitos não-funcionais do que aos funcionais.
D) Um requisito é uma funcionalidade do sistema ou capacidade que pode ser validada e encontrada ou possuída por um sistema para resolver um problema do cliente ou para atingir um objetivo do usuário - Esta definição está correta, pois descreve de forma precisa o que são requisitos funcionais.
E) Os requisitos não-funcionais são declarações de funções que o sistema deve fornecer, como o sistema deve reagir a entradas específicas e como deve se comportar em determinadas situações - Esta definição está incorreta, pois se refere mais aos requisitos funcionais do que aos não-funcionais.
Portanto, a definição correta dos conceitos apresentados é a opção D) Um requisito é uma funcionalidade do sistema ou capacidade que pode ser validada e encontrada ou possuída por um sistema para resolver um problema do cliente ou para atingir um objetivo do usuário.
Ed Inteligência Artificial do Passei Direto
há 11 meses
A pergunta apresenta uma análise das definições de requisitos funcionais e não-funcionais. A alternativa correta é a que descreve de forma precisa o que são requisitos funcionais. Analisando as definições apresentadas nas alternativas, temos: A) Os requisitos funcionais podem ser expressos como metas que caracterizam as propriedades do sistema e seus objetivos - Esta definição não está correta, pois os requisitos funcionais são as funcionalidades específicas que o sistema deve fornecer. B) Os requisitos não-funcionais são declarações de todos os serviços e restrições que o software deve possuir, mediante as necessidades do cliente ou usuário - Esta definição está correta, pois os requisitos não-funcionais referem-se a aspectos como desempenho, segurança, usabilidade, entre outros, que não são funcionalidades específicas do sistema. C) Os requisitos funcionais são declarações que definem as qualidades globais ou atributos a serem atendidos pelo sistema resultante - Esta definição não está correta, pois se refere mais aos requisitos não-funcionais do que aos funcionais. D) Um requisito é uma funcionalidade do sistema ou capacidade que pode ser validada e encontrada ou possuída por um sistema para resolver um problema do cliente ou para atingir um objetivo do usuário - Esta definição está correta, pois descreve de forma precisa o que são requisitos funcionais. E) Os requisitos não-funcionais são declarações de funções que o sistema deve fornecer, como o sistema deve reagir a entradas específicas e como deve se comportar em determinadas situações - Esta definição está incorreta, pois se refere mais aos requisitos funcionais do que aos não-funcionais. Portanto, a definição correta dos conceitos apresentados é a opção D) Um requisito é uma funcionalidade do sistema ou capacidade que pode ser validada e encontrada ou possuída por um sistema para resolver um problema do cliente ou para atingir um objetivo do usuário.